What Makes Women’s Pants Suitable for Kayaking?
Women’s pants suitable for kayaking should possess specific features to enhance comfort, mobility, and protection during water activities. Key characteristics include:
Feature | Description |
---|---|
Water Resistance | Pants made from quick-drying, water-resistant materials help keep the wearer dry and comfortable. |
Breathability | Fabrics that allow moisture to escape prevent overheating and promote comfort. |
Flexibility | Stretchable materials enable a full range of motion, essential for paddling. |
Durability | Reinforced seams and robust materials withstand abrasion from equipment and rough surfaces. |
Fit | A snug but comfortable fit prevents chafing while allowing for freedom of movement. |
UV Protection | Some pants offer UV protection, shielding the skin from harmful sun exposure during long hours on the water. |
Pockets | Functional pockets can be useful for storing small items securely while on the water. |
Insulation | Some kayaking pants may provide insulation for colder conditions, keeping the wearer warm. |
Quick-Drying | Quick-drying fabrics are essential for comfort after getting wet. |

Comfort is essential in kayaking pants. Kayaking involves various movements, and comfortable pants allow for unrestricted mobility. A good pair keeps you dry and avoids chafing. Moisture-wicking fabric helps manage sweat by moving moisture away from the skin. This prevents discomfort and maintains temperatures during paddling sessions. Durability is crucial for those frequently in and out of water. High-quality materials resist wear and tear, surviving abrasions from equipment or rocks. Flexibility allows freedom of movement. Pants designed for active use often offer stretch, enabling paddlers to maneuver freely.
Quick-drying properties are vital for any kayaking activity. Pants made from synthetic materials dry faster, minimizing cold exposure after being in water. UV protection is also important when you spend hours outdoors. Many kayaking pants incorporate fabric that blocks harmful sun rays, reducing skin damage risk. Pockets and storage provide convenience for carrying essentials, such as keys or snacks, especially during longer trips. Lastly, fit and sizing options ensure that everyone can find a comfortable fit. Women can choose from various styles and cuts to suit their body types and preferences.

What Types of Women’s Pants Are Best for Various Kayaking Conditions?
The best types of women’s pants for various kayaking conditions include quick-drying pants, waterproof pants, insulated pants, and lightweight leggings.
- Quick-Drying Pants
- Waterproof Pants
- Insulated Pants
- Lightweight Leggings
When selecting pants for kayaking, consider factors such as temperature, water exposure, and comfort. Each type of pant has unique features suited for different conditions.
-
Quick-Drying Pants:
Quick-drying pants are designed for water-related activities. These pants use synthetic materials that wick moisture away quickly. Fabrics like nylon or polyester allow for rapid evaporation and enhance comfort during kayaking. How Should You Care for Your Women’s Kayaking Pants to Ensure Longevity?
Care for your women’s kayaking pants properly to ensure their longevity. Follow basic washing guidelines and handle them with care. Most kayaking pants are designed to be durable, often made from materials that resist water, stains, and abrasion. Their lifespan can significantly increase with the right maintenance.
Start by washing your kayaking pants in cold water on a gentle cycle to prevent wear. Use mild detergent to avoid harsh chemicals that could damage the fabric. Avoid using fabric softeners, as they can reduce the pants’ water-resistant properties. Drying should be done on low heat or air drying to prevent shrinking or fading.
Store your kayaking pants in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ight. Sunlight can break down the material over time, leading to discoloration and damage. For long-term storage, consider folding them neatly instead of hanging them, which can create unwanted creases.

Remember that exposure to salty water and chlorine from pools can also affect the fabric. Rinse your pants promptly after use in saltwater or chlorinated environments to avoid any material breakdown. Additionally, be cautious with sharp objects and surfaces that can cause tears.
Environmental factors like humidity and temperature can also influence the care of your kayaking pants. High humidity can slow drying times, while extreme temperatures can affect the fabric’s flexibility. Therefore, consider these conditions when planning maintenance and storage.
